Somewhere between $100 and $150. That is for a power flush. This will also change out the fluid in the torque converter. They will usually undo the transmission cooler lines and hook the machine in series with the cooler. The machine will be loaded with new fluid and you can actually see the old discolored come out and the new fluid going in. Once the fluid coming out turns reddish, then all of the fluid has been replaced and the cooling lines are reconnected and the topped off.

Automatic Transmission oil can cost as little as $1.50 per quart. What kind of AT do you have? Some ATs hold 7 to 10 quarts of AT Fluid. Some BMWs use a ';lifetime'; transmission fluid which costs $150 per quart. Some transmissions have a dip-stick to measure the AT Fluid level. You should make sure the car is on level ground, and that the existing AT Fluid is warmed up to at least 120 degrees F. With the engine running, you can add 1/2 quart of the appropriate AT Fluid until you see the level on the dipstick. Do not overfill. Many Auto Transmissions require that you change a filter screen in the AT Pan every 50,000 miles. A filter and 10 quarts of AT Fluid can cost $200. You should look in your Owner's Manual for complete instructions on your peculiar car.
